News

A new peace declaration between Armenia and Azerbaijan, brokered by the US, aims to transform the Caucasus, but faces significant obstacles from Russia, Iran, and unresolved internal issues.
The major force for peace in the world today is not the United Nations (UN), it is President Donald Trump. In his four ½ ...